The Rise of a Country Music Icon

Thomas Rhett Akins, Jr., born on March 30, 1990, in Valdosta, Georgia, is the son of country singer Rhett Akins. He signed with Big Machine Label Group's Valory Music imprint in 2010, marking the beginning of his professional music career. His debut album, It Goes Like This, released in 2013, spawned multiple hit singles, setting the stage for his future success.

Milestones in His Career

  • Breakthrough Success: His early singles like "It Goes Like This" and "Get Me Some of That" quickly climbed the charts, establishing him as a rising star in country music.
  • Critical Acclaim: Albums such as Tangled Up and Life Changes received critical acclaim, solidifying his position as a leading figure in the genre.
  • Awards and Recognition: Thomas Rhett has won numerous awards, including multiple Academy of Country Music (ACM) Awards and Country Music Association (CMA) Awards, recognizing his contributions to the industry.
